Choose the Right Server: The first step is to find a Minecraft multiplayer server that aligns with your interests and gameplay style. There are various types of servers available, including survival, creative, minigames, factions, roleplay, and more. Take your time to research and explore different server options. Consider factors such as server population, rules, server stability, and community reputation. Look for servers with active player bases and positive feedback from the community.
Connect and Engage: Once you have selected a server, join the community and start connecting with other players. Introduce yourself, engage in conversations, and participate in server activities. Minecraft multiplayer servers often have chat channels, forums, or Discord servers where players can interact and collaborate. Make an effort to be friendly, respectful, and helpful to build positive relationships within the community.

Participate in Events: Many Minecraft multiplayer servers organize special events, competitions, or challenges for their community. These events can range from building contests to PvP tournaments or scavenger hunts. Participating in events not only adds excitement to your gameplay but also allows you to interact with other players and showcase your skills. Be active in the server community, stay informed about upcoming events, and take part in the festivities.
Respect Server Rules and Guidelines: Each Minecraft multiplayer server has its own set of rules and guidelines that ensure a fair and enjoyable experience for all players. Familiarize yourself with the server's rules and respect them. Avoid griefing, cheating, or engaging in toxic behavior that can disrupt the community. By adhering to the server's rules, you contribute to a positive and welcoming environment where everyone can have fun.
